Exploring the Antarctic Peninsula is an experience like no other, with glacial landscapes, unique wildlife and a profound sense of isolation creating lasting memories. This Scenic Expedition Voyage takes you further, with a rare visit to Snow Hill Island in the Weddell Sea, home to 4,000 breeding pairs of Emperor penguins. The Falkland Islands blend white-sand beaches, aquamarine waters and historic settlements with lively Gentoo penguin colonies. Discover the region’s history, including the 1980s Falklands War. Often called the Galapagos of the Poles, South Georgia features towering peaks, vast King penguin colonies and the story of Shackleton’s legendary expedition.
